
Phenix进行数据分析的方法包括:数据收集、数据清洗、数据转换、数据可视化、数据建模、报告生成。其中,数据可视化是数据分析过程中至关重要的一环。数据可视化是通过图表、图形等形式将数据直观地展示出来,帮助用户更好地理解数据背后的信息。通过数据可视化,可以有效地发现数据中的趋势、模式和异常,辅助决策。Phenix提供多种可视化工具和图表类型,用户可以根据需要选择合适的图表来展示数据,例如柱状图、折线图、饼图等。此外,Phenix还支持自定义图表样式,使得数据展示更加个性化和专业化。
一、数据收集
数据收集是数据分析的第一步,直接影响后续分析的准确性和有效性。Phenix提供了多种数据源接口,支持从数据库、文件、API等多种途径进行数据收集。用户可以根据需求选择合适的数据源进行连接。在数据收集过程中,需要注意数据的准确性和完整性,确保收集到的数据能够真实反映实际情况。
常见的数据源包括:
- 数据库:MySQL、PostgreSQL、SQL Server等。
- 文件:CSV、Excel、JSON等。
- API:RESTful API、GraphQL等。
二、数据清洗
数据清洗是数据分析中不可或缺的一部分,旨在去除数据中的噪声和错误,提升数据质量。Phenix提供了多种数据清洗工具,帮助用户快速、准确地清洗数据。数据清洗的主要步骤包括:去重、填补缺失值、处理异常值、标准化数据格式等。
数据清洗的常见方法有:
- 去重:删除重复的记录,确保数据的唯一性。
- 填补缺失值:使用均值、中位数或其他合理的方法填补缺失值。
- 处理异常值:识别并处理数据中的异常值,确保数据的真实性。
- 标准化数据格式:统一数据的格式,如日期格式、数值格式等。
三、数据转换
数据转换是指将原始数据转换为适合分析的格式和结构。Phenix支持多种数据转换操作,如数据聚合、数据分组、数据透视等。通过数据转换,可以将复杂的数据简化为易于理解和分析的形式,提升数据分析的效率和效果。
常见的数据转换操作包括:
- 数据聚合:对数据进行汇总,如求和、计数、平均值等。
- 数据分组:根据某一或多列进行数据分组,方便后续的分析。
- 数据透视:将数据转换为透视表形式,便于多维度分析。
四、数据可视化
数据可视化是数据分析的重要环节,通过图表、图形等形式直观地展示数据,帮助用户更好地理解数据背后的信息。Phenix提供了丰富的数据可视化工具和图表类型,用户可以根据需要选择合适的图表进行数据展示。常见的图表类型包括柱状图、折线图、饼图、散点图等。
数据可视化的常见方法有:
- 柱状图:用于比较不同类别的数据。
- 折线图:用于展示数据的变化趋势。
- 饼图:用于展示数据的组成比例。
- 散点图:用于展示数据的分布情况。
五、数据建模
数据建模是数据分析的高级阶段,通过建立数学模型来描述数据的规律和关系。Phenix支持多种数据建模方法,如回归分析、分类、聚类等。通过数据建模,可以预测数据的未来趋势,发现数据中的潜在规律,辅助决策。
常见的数据建模方法包括:
- 回归分析:用于预测连续型变量,如线性回归、非线性回归等。
- 分类:用于将数据分为不同的类别,如决策树、随机森林等。
- 聚类:用于将数据分为不同的组,如K-means聚类、层次聚类等。
六、报告生成
报告生成是数据分析的最后一步,通过生成专业的分析报告,展示数据分析的结果。Phenix提供了多种报告生成工具,用户可以根据需要选择合适的报告模板进行报告生成。报告生成的主要步骤包括:报告设计、数据填充、报告导出等。
报告生成的常见方法有:
- 报告设计:根据需求设计报告的结构和内容。
- 数据填充:将分析结果填充到报告中。
- 报告导出:将报告导出为PDF、Word等格式,便于分享和存档。
为了更好地进行数据分析,还可以借助FineBI这一强大的BI工具。FineBI是帆软旗下的产品,提供了丰富的数据分析功能,支持多种数据源、数据清洗、数据转换、数据可视化、数据建模等。通过FineBI,用户可以更加高效、准确地进行数据分析,生成专业的分析报告。FineBI官网: https://s.fanruan.com/f459r;。
Phenix和FineBI都是强大的数据分析工具,各有特色和优势。用户可以根据自己的需求选择合适的工具进行数据分析,从而提升数据分析的效率和效果。
相关问答FAQs:
1. 什么是Phenix,为什么它在数据分析中如此重要?
Phenix(Python-based Hierarchical Environment for Integrated Xtallography)是一个强大的开源软件框架,主要用于晶体学数据的处理和分析。它的设计旨在为科学家提供一个集成的环境,以便于进行复杂的计算和数据分析。Phenix的强大之处在于它能够处理多种类型的晶体学数据,包括X射线衍射数据和电子显微镜数据。
在科学研究中,数据的准确性和可靠性至关重要。Phenix通过提供一系列工具,使研究人员能够对数据进行深入分析,从而提取有价值的信息。它不仅能处理和分析数据,还能进行结构模型的构建、优化和验证。这使得Phenix成为生物学、化学和材料科学等领域研究人员的重要工具。
2. 如何使用Phenix进行数据分析?
使用Phenix进行数据分析的过程可以分为几个主要步骤。首先,用户需要安装Phenix软件并确保其依赖项已正确配置。安装完成后,可以通过命令行或图形用户界面(GUI)启动分析。
接下来,用户可以导入数据文件。Phenix支持多种数据格式,如MTZ和PDB文件,这使得用户能够灵活地选择合适的输入数据。在导入数据后,用户需要进行数据预处理,包括去噪、归一化和缺失值填补等操作。这些步骤对于确保后续分析的准确性至关重要。
在数据处理完成后,用户可以选择使用Phenix的各种工具进行进一步分析。例如,用户可以使用“phenix.refine”命令进行结构优化,或使用“phenix.pdbtools”进行结构验证。这些工具能够帮助研究人员识别和修正潜在的结构错误,从而提高最终结果的可靠性。
最后,用户可以将分析结果导出,生成相应的报告和图表,以便于后续的研究和论文撰写。Phenix不仅支持数据分析,还能生成高质量的可视化结果,帮助研究人员更好地理解数据和结构之间的关系。
3. 在数据分析过程中可能遇到的常见问题及解决方案是什么?
在使用Phenix进行数据分析的过程中,用户可能会遇到一些常见问题。理解这些问题及其解决方案,可以帮助研究人员更高效地使用Phenix。
一个常见的问题是数据导入失败。这通常是由于数据格式不兼容或者文件路径错误引起的。为了解决这个问题,用户应仔细检查数据文件的格式,并确保路径无误。此外,Phenix的文档中提供了支持的文件格式列表,用户可以参考这一信息进行数据准备。
另一个常见问题是分析结果不如预期,可能是由于数据质量不佳或参数设置不当。用户可以通过调整分析参数,或者回到数据预处理阶段,确保数据的完整性和准确性。Phenix提供了多种选项供用户调整,比如选择不同的优化算法或调整反复迭代的次数。
此外,用户在使用Phenix时可能会对某些功能不熟悉,导致无法充分利用软件的潜力。为了解决这个问题,用户可以参考Phenix的官方文档和在线教程,这些资源详细介绍了各种工具的使用方法和最佳实践。社区论坛和用户交流群也是获取帮助和分享经验的良好渠道。
通过了解这些常见问题及其解决方案,用户可以更顺利地使用Phenix进行数据分析,提高研究效率,最终获得更为准确和可靠的结果。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



